What is ADHD ADHD is a neurodevelopmental condition identified by consistent patterns of negligence andor hyperactivityimpulsivity that hinder functioning or advancement In iampsychiatry it can manifest differently than in children typically leading to complications in numerous aspects of life
Symptoms of ADHD in Adults The signs of ADHD in grownups can be broadly categorized into two domains inattention and hyperactivityimpulsivity The table listed below sums up these symptoms
Symptom Type Symptoms Negligence Problem sustaining attention in jobs Often making careless mistakes Problems arranging jobs and activities Preventing jobs that need sustained psychological effort Losing things required for jobs Quickly distracted by extraneous stimuli Lapse of memory in everyday activities HyperactivityImpulsivity Fidgeting or tapping hands or feet Trouble staying seated in circumstances where anticipated Sensations of uneasyness Talking excessively Disrupting or invading others Problem waiting for ones turn The ADHD Diagnosis Process for Adults Diagnosing ADHD in grownups can be complicated due to overlapping symptoms with other psychological health disorders such as anxiety and depression The following steps detail the common procedure for diagnosis
1 Medical Interview A mental health professional performs a detailed interview gathering information relating to the individuals history symptoms and their influence on every day life 2 Symptom Rating Scales Standardized surveys and rating scales are used to evaluate the frequency and seriousness of signs Typical tools include the Adult ADHD SelfReport Scale ASRS and the Conners Adult ADHD Rating Scale 3 Medical Evaluation A comprehensive medical assessment is performed to dismiss other conditions that may simulate ADHD symptoms such as thyroid concerns or sleep conditions 4 Security Information Input from member of the family partners or friends can supply extra insights into the persons habits and operating in various settings 5 Diagnostic Criteria The clinician utilizes the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ders DSM5 criteria to validate the diagnosis According to the DSM5 symptoms need to exist for a minimum of 6 months and have started in youth Step Description Clinical Interview Detailed discussion about signs and history Sign Rating Scales Standardized tools to assess symptom intensity Medical Evaluation Checking for other possible conditions Collateral Information Insights from people close to the individual Diagnostic Criteria Usage of DSM5 to verify diagnosis Typical Challenges in ADHD Diagnosis for Adults Adults might deal with specific obstacles when seeking an ADHD diagnosis such as
Misdiagnosis Symptoms may be mistaken for other conditions eg stress and anxiety mood conditions Preconception There is a social stigma connected with mental health conditions leading lots of to be reluctant in looking for help Underreporting Adults may lessen their signs or think they ought to have outgrown childhood ADHD Complexity of Symptoms The variability in symptoms can complicate the diagnostic process Management and Treatment of Adult ADHD When detected ADHD can be handled through a mix of approaches
Medication Stimulants These are the most typical treatment including medications like methylphenidate and amphetamines Nonstimulants Options like atomoxetine and guanfacine are offered for those who can not endure stimulants Psychotherapy Cognitive Behavioral Therapy CBT Helps individuals establish coping techniques and customize behaviors Skillbuilding Training Focuses on organizational skills time management and methods to improve performance Lifestyle Changes Routine Exercise Physical activity can lower symptoms and enhance state of mind Healthy Diet A balanced diet plan with adequate nutrients supports overall mental health Mindfulness Practices Techniques such as meditation can improve attention and lower impulsivity Treatment Type Description Medication Stimulants and nonstimulants for symptom control Psychiatric therapy CBT and skillbuilding to handle signs Lifestyle Changes Workout diet plan and mindfulness practices Frequently Asked Questions FAQ 1 Can ADHD be identified in their adult years Yes ADHD can be identified in their adult years Lots of grownups have signs that have actually gone unacknowledged because childhood
2 What are the most typical symptoms of adult ADHD In adults common signs consist of trouble focusing forgetfulness impulsivity and uneasyness
3 Is it possible to grow out of ADHD While some kids may see a decrease in signs as they age numerous individuals continue to experience signs of ADHD into adulthood
4 How can I discover a specialist for ADHD diagnosis Browse for mental health experts specializing in adult ADHD try to find those with experience in diagnosing and treating ADHD
5 What should I expect during a diagnostic examination Expect a thorough interview questionnaires and perhaps a review of your history and behaviors together with security details from people near to you
Identifying ADHD in grownups is a nuanced process that requires an understanding of the conditions intricacies By recognizing signs looking for a thorough assessment and exploring treatment options adults with ADHD can lead satisfying productive lives Awareness and understanding of the condition are vital for lowering stigma and motivating individuals to look for required assistance and management techniques
